The notecard's source information can be found in the top right corner.
The upper right-hand corner of the notecard is typically where the author's name and/or the page number where the information on the card was located are written. If you're utilizing source cards, there may be a source number in the top right corner, allowing you to look up the relevant information on your source card. The issue the material will address, or support should be included in the notecard i title at the top.
